The vapour pressure of water is 12.3kPa at 300K . Calculate vapour pressure of 1 molal solution of a solute in it. Select the correct answer from above options

Correct Answer - Ps=12.08kPa p∘=12.3kPa,pS=? M=1(1mole of solute is dissolved in 1L of solution ) Molarity of water = 1000 18 =55.56 ( or number of moles of water =55.56) p∘-pS p∘ =CHMi2= n2 n1+n2 = n2 n1 ( for dilute solution ) 12.3-pS 12.3 = 1 55.56 12.30pS= 12.3 55.56 =0.2213 pS=12.3-0.2213=12.078≈12.08kPa
